The North American Thebaid Photographic Pilgrimage Project is a unique creative endeavor, intended to convey the beauty and mystery of Orthodox Christian monasticism in the USA and Canada, and to help inspire a new generation of monks and nuns right here in North America. Through your financial support, we’ll be able to schedule travel and photography to begin in Autumn 2016.
